Abstract: (SISSA)
The latest measurements of the CKM angle γ\gamma, using data collected by the LHCb experiment, are presented.These include a time-integrated analysis of B±DK±B^{\pm}\to D K^{\pm} decays, where DKS0hhD\to K_{S}^{0} hh, and a decay-time-dependent analysis ofB0Dπ±B^0\to D^{\mp}\pi^{\pm} decays, both presented here for the first time. In addition, an updated LHCb combination of the CKMangle γ\gamma, produced for this conference, is shown. This combination yieldsγ=(74.05.8+5.0)\gamma = (74.0^{+5.0}_{-5.8})^{\circ} which dominates the world average,also presented here. Finally, an overview of the status and future prospects ofγ\gamma measurements with LHCb future upgrades is discussed.
